Heres our reference letter template: Dear [insert name], I am writing to recommend [employeename]. [He/She/They] worked with us at [companyname] as a [employeejobtitle] and [reported to me/ worked with me] in my position as [insert your job title]. As an employee, [employeename] was always [insert quality].
Good examples of professional references include: College professors, coaches or other advisors (especially if youre a recent college graduate or dont have a lengthy work history) Former employer (the person who hired and paid you)
How to write a business a reference letter Collect all the required information. List positive experiences with the company. Obtain the names of all key people of the company. Address the recipient by name and title. Enter the subject line as Recommendation or Reference. Write the contents.
A professional letter of recommendation generally follows the standard business letter format and should fill one page. The business letter format necessitates having a letterhead, which includes the authors name, title, and contact information, the date, and the addressees name, title, and contact information.
Be specific. Please feel free to use a template (like the one above) to guide your writing, but remember to make it personal. Use examples and specific details to illustrate why this person is the best candidate. Choose strong, accurate adjectives over general terms or cliches.
The parts of the letter include: Introduction and statement of recommendation. List of specific reasons you are recommending them to the position. Personal story with evidence of their qualities (soft and hard skills) Closing statement with contact information. Signature.

A successful letter should avoid: General language or overly broad descriptors of the students performance in the classroom; Focusing on a students punctuality or ability to complete the readings. Too much time and attention detailing the relationship with the student or the content of the course.
